Anomalous object interaction detection and reporting

This invention describes a system that watches video from a camera to spot unusual interactions between objects. It works by tracking objects, breaking their movements into short sequences, and comparing these sequences to learned patterns of normal interactions. If an interaction's pattern is rare or doesn't fit the learned norms, the system flags it as an anomaly and issues an alert. The system specifically defines an interaction as two objects' bounding boxes coming very close to each other.
